Superb location, beach is right next to the property. plenty of decent dining options. Older building and dated furniture but it was functional just that it was not fancy. You will need to rent a car if you would like to visit other locations.
This resort is right on the beach, which makes this resort great. The units themselves are a little outdated. The furniture is uncomfortable and old The units are very clean and all precautions are met due to COVID. The bathroom tub might be difficult for seniors with knee problems or balance issues. The kitchen is stocked but needs to have some items updated ( steak knives, carving knife). Electric outlets are a challenge, you might want to bring extension cords for charging phones, tablets, etc.. All in all, a great place, with great staff.
